Dishes
SpamSpam is a canned food product made primarily from pork, processed through grinding, seasoning, and steaming. It has a fine texture and delicious taste, commonly used as an ingredient in hot pot, barbecue dishes, or eaten directly sliced.
Double-Flavor Taro ChickenA Sichuan dish combining chicken and taro, simmered with spicy chili and fermented bean paste for a rich, numbingly spicy flavor.
Potato SlicesPotato slices are a simple home-style dish, with potatoes as the main ingredient. The method involves washing and peeling the potatoes, slicing them thinly, and then cooking them by stir-frying, frying, or baking. During cooking, garlic slices and chili peppers are often added to enhance flavor, and salt is used for seasoning at the end.
Dry Pot Chicken with TaroA spicy Sichuan dish featuring chicken and taro cooked in a dry pot style, seasoned with chili, garlic, and fermented bean paste.
Bamboo Shoot and Taro ChickenA Sichuan-style dish made with chicken, bamboo shoots, and taro, simmered in a spicy sauce for rich, savory flavor.
TofuTofu is a food made primarily from soybeans, formed through multiple processes including soaking, grinding, boiling the pulp, and coagulation. It has a white, block-like shape, a delicate texture, a tender taste, and is highly nutritious. It can be used to prepare various dishes such as Mapo Tofu and tofu pudding.
Sour Cabbage and Taro ChickenA Sichuan-style dish made with chicken, sour cabbage, and taro, stir-fried and simmered until tender and flavorful.
KonjacKonjac is a food made from the corm of the konjac plant, processed into a gel-like texture with a smooth and refreshing mouthfeel. The main ingredients are konjac powder and water, and an alkaline substance is added during processing to solidify the konjac. It can be sliced, shredded, or used whole, and is commonly used in cold dishes, stir-fries, or soups.
